Hmm...yeah its the mature Acetabularia, having size around 0.5 to 10 cm tall and has three anatomical parts, its rhizoid, a short set of root-like appendages that contain the nucleus and anchor the cell to fissures in a substrate; its median stalk, which accounts for most of its length; and its apex, where its cap forms.
